If you grew up a theater-kid, you might like this one. Love and showbiz! I liked this one because there's nothing particularly violent or weird, just a good old "beat them at their own game" revenge story mixed with self-discovery and new romance an...
Skip Beat! 3-in-1 Edition, Vol. 1|Paperback
Age 14/15+ due to some violence and suggestive themes

Claymore- if you like demons and gore and swords, this was a pretty good one. A bit chaotic, but it also has an anime to check out. 18+ due to graphic violence, partial nudity

Join Natsume as he unwittingly gets dragged into dealing with spirits. A wholesome series overall with minimal mature themes except for some possibly sad character stories. Age 10+
